magic water information online

2128 Fremont St.
Rockford, Illinois 61103
(815) 227-9281

Learn More
P.O Box 2424
Loves Park, Illinois 61132
815-997-6366

Learn More
82 Prairie Hill Road
South Beloit, Illinois 61080
(815) 965-PAVE

Learn More
1885 Business Route 20
Belvidere, Illinois 61107
(815) 397-1223

Learn More
-
Roscoe, Illinois 61073
815-623-7385

Learn More